日韩在线电影_国产不卡在线_久久99精品久久久久久国产越南_欧美激情一区二区三区_国产一区二区三区亚洲_国产在线高清

當(dāng)前位置 主頁 > 技術(shù)大全 >

    Linux KMS驅(qū)動:性能與兼容性的優(yōu)化之旅
    linux kms驅(qū)動

    欄目:技術(shù)大全 時間:2024-12-21 00:49



    Linux KMS驅(qū)動:提升系統(tǒng)性能與穩(wěn)定性的關(guān)鍵 在Linux操作系統(tǒng)中,KMS(Kernel Mode Setting)驅(qū)動扮演著至關(guān)重要的角色,特別是在圖形顯示方面

        KMS驅(qū)動作為Linux內(nèi)核的核心模塊,負責(zé)初始化、配置和驅(qū)動圖形硬件,確保圖形顯示系統(tǒng)的正常運行

        本文將深入探討Linux KMS驅(qū)動的工作原理、優(yōu)化策略以及在實際應(yīng)用中的重要性,以幫助讀者更好地理解并優(yōu)化這一關(guān)鍵技術(shù)

         KMS驅(qū)動的工作原理 KMS(Kernel Mode Setting)是一種內(nèi)核級別的模式設(shè)置技術(shù),它允許Linux內(nèi)核直接管理和配置顯示設(shè)備

        這包括顯示器的分辨率、刷新率、色彩深度等關(guān)鍵參數(shù)

        與傳統(tǒng)的X Window System(X11)相比,KMS提供了更高的圖形性能和更好的顯示效果

        在Linux內(nèi)核加載期間,KMS驅(qū)動會自動初始化和管理圖形硬件,確保在啟動時設(shè)置正確的分辨率和色彩模式

         KMS驅(qū)動通過內(nèi)核模塊與圖形硬件進行交互,實現(xiàn)硬件的初始化和配置

        在啟動過程中,KMS驅(qū)動會加載相應(yīng)的驅(qū)動程序,并與硬件進行通信,確保圖形顯示系統(tǒng)的正常運行

        這種機制不僅提高了系統(tǒng)的性能,還增強了系統(tǒng)的穩(wěn)定性和可靠性

         KMS驅(qū)動的優(yōu)化策略 為了充分發(fā)揮KMS驅(qū)動的性能,需要制定有效的優(yōu)化策略

        以下是一些關(guān)鍵的優(yōu)化措施: 1.確保KMS驅(qū)動與硬件兼容: 優(yōu)化KMS驅(qū)動的第一步是確保其與硬件兼容

        不同硬件可能需要不同的驅(qū)動程序和配置參數(shù)

        因此,在選擇和配置KMS驅(qū)動時,需要充分考慮硬件的特性和需求

        通過選擇合適的驅(qū)動程序和配置參數(shù),可以充分發(fā)揮硬件性能,提升系統(tǒng)整體性能

         2.優(yōu)化驅(qū)動程序代碼: 驅(qū)動程序代碼的效率直接影響KMS驅(qū)動的性能

        優(yōu)化驅(qū)動程序代碼,減少冗余操作,優(yōu)化內(nèi)存管理等,可以降低驅(qū)動程序的資源消耗,提高執(zhí)行效率

        例如,通過減少不必要的內(nèi)存復(fù)制和緩存操作,可以降低CPU和內(nèi)存的占用,從而提升系統(tǒng)的響應(yīng)速度和穩(wěn)定性

         3.調(diào)整系統(tǒng)配置參數(shù): 系統(tǒng)配置參數(shù)對KMS驅(qū)動的性能也有重要影響

        例如,圖形緩沖區(qū)大小、幀緩沖區(qū)分配策略等參數(shù),可以根據(jù)實際使用場景進行調(diào)整

        通過調(diào)整這些參數(shù),可以優(yōu)化圖形顯示系統(tǒng)的性能,提升用戶體驗

         4.根據(jù)系統(tǒng)負載調(diào)整工作模式: KMS驅(qū)動的工作模式應(yīng)根據(jù)系統(tǒng)負載進行調(diào)整

        在低負載情況下,可以采用節(jié)能模式,降低功耗和發(fā)熱;在高負載情況下,應(yīng)采用高性能模式,確保系統(tǒng)的流暢運行

        這種動態(tài)調(diào)整不僅可以提高系統(tǒng)的性能,還可以延長硬件的使用壽命

         KMS驅(qū)動在實際應(yīng)用中的重要性 KMS驅(qū)動在Linux系統(tǒng)中的重要性不言而喻

        它不僅提高了系統(tǒng)的圖形性能和顯示效果,還為用戶提供了更好的用戶體驗

        以下是一些KMS驅(qū)動在實際應(yīng)用中的典型場景和案例: 1.高性能圖形應(yīng)用: 在需要高性能圖形處理的應(yīng)用中,如游戲、視頻編輯、3D渲染等,KMS驅(qū)動可以顯著提升系統(tǒng)的圖形性能

        通過優(yōu)化驅(qū)動程序和系統(tǒng)配置,可以確保這些應(yīng)用在Linux系統(tǒng)上流暢運行,滿足用戶的需求

         2.多顯示器支持: KMS驅(qū)動支持多顯示器配置,可以根據(jù)用戶的需求靈活設(shè)置顯示模式和分辨率

        這對于需要同時處理多個顯示設(shè)備的用戶來說尤為重要,如設(shè)計師、程序員等

        通過KMS驅(qū)動,他們可以輕松實現(xiàn)多顯示器同步顯示,提高工作效率

         3.遠程桌面和虛擬化: 在遠程桌面和虛擬化環(huán)境中,KMS驅(qū)動也發(fā)揮著重要作用

        通過優(yōu)化KMS驅(qū)動,可以降低網(wǎng)絡(luò)延遲和帶寬占用,提高遠程桌面的響應(yīng)速度和穩(wěn)定性

        這對于需要遠程辦公或遠程教育的用戶來說尤為重要

         4.嵌入式系統(tǒng): 在嵌入式系統(tǒng)中,KMS驅(qū)動同樣扮演著關(guān)鍵角色

        由于嵌入式系統(tǒng)通常對功耗和性能有嚴格要求,KMS驅(qū)動的優(yōu)化尤為重要

        通過調(diào)整KMS驅(qū)動的工作模式和配置參數(shù),可以確保嵌入式系統(tǒng)在低功耗下保持高性能運行

         KMS驅(qū)動的優(yōu)化案例 以下是一個針對NVIDIA GeForce GTX 1080顯卡的KMS驅(qū)動優(yōu)化案例: 1.確保驅(qū)動程序與硬件兼容: 首先,確保選擇了與NVIDIA GeForce GTX 1080顯卡兼容的驅(qū)動程序版本

        這可以通過查看顯卡的官方文檔或驅(qū)動支持列表來確定

         2.優(yōu)化驅(qū)動程序代碼: 對NVIDIA

主站蜘蛛池模板: 国产精品伊人影院 | 国产免费一区二区三区 | 国产小视频在线 | 免费a级毛片在线观看 | 成年人在线看片 | 国产一区二区av在线 | 国产欧美日韩综合精品一区二区 | 香蕉依人 | 欧美一级欧美三级在线观看 | 国产一区二区av | 国内精品久久久久 | 久久久久久久久久久免费视频 | 日韩视频在线一区二区 | av电影免费观看 | jizz中国女人高潮 | 欧美日本精品 | 久久一区 | 欧美日韩免费一区二区三区 | 999国产在线观看 | 久久久久久99| 久久国产综合 | 国产精品毛片久久久久久久 | 美女久久久久 | 欧美在线观看一区 | 欧美一区二区三区在线看 | 欧美激情一区二区 | 2018自拍偷拍 | 毛片在线一区二区观看精品 | 欧美一区在线看 | 亚洲午夜精品 | 国产精品免费看 | 亚洲伊人久久综合 | 国产精品免费观看 | 亚洲电影在线播放 | 日本精品视频在线观看 | 欧美成人精品一区二区男人看 | 免费看男女www网站入口在线 | 久草中文在线 | 免费观看全黄做爰大片国产 | 国产乱码精品一区二区三区忘忧草 | 欧洲精品久久久久69精品 |